Setting Up Chrome Remote Desktop for Gaming
Step 1: Access the Chrome Remote Desktop Website
Start by visiting the Chrome Remote Desktop website on the host PC. Click on Download on the right side. You can skip this step if you have already installed the application.
Step 2: Add Chrome Remote Desktop
Click on Add to Chrome, then select Accept & Install.
Step 3: Enable Remote Desktop
You will be prompted to enable Remote Desktop; click on Turn On.
Step 4: Set Your Computer Name
Name your computer and click Next.
Step 5: Create a Secure PIN
Establish a 6-digit PIN, confirm it, and select Start.
Step 6: Confirm Connection Status
Your Chrome Remote Desktop is now live on your computer.
Step 7: Install on Secondary Device
On your second device, repeat the installation process for Chrome Remote Desktop.
Step 8: Connect via the Same Network
Ensure this device is on the same network as the host and log in with the same Google account.
Step 9: Start a Remote Session
Click on Remote Access and select the PC you want to connect to.
Step 10: Input Your PIN
Enter the previously set 6-digit PIN to access the host computer.
Step 11: Launch and Enjoy Your Game
Finally, start the game you want to play remotely on your host PC and enjoy!
Pro Tip: For the best gameplay experience, ensure you are using a fast and stable internet connection.
Using Chrome Remote Desktop for gaming can be effective, especially for less graphics-intensive games. For optimal performance, use a robust gaming rig as the host if you wish to play modern titles.
Additionally, you can play games remotely using Android and iOS devices. Simply download the Chrome Remote Desktop app from the Google Play Store or the App Store. Enter your 6-digit PIN, and you are ready to go!

FAQ (Frequently Asked Questions)
Can I use Chrome Remote Desktop for high-performance gaming?
While Chrome Remote Desktop can handle simpler games well, high-performance or graphically intense games may not perform optimally.
Is it possible to connect from a mobile device?
Yes, you can access your games from Android and iOS devices using the Chrome Remote Desktop app.
